Mr. Yuichi Tsujimoto was named Director in Hitachi Construction Machinery Co., Ltd. effective April 1, 2017. He is also a member of Nominating Committee and Compensation Committee of the Company. He joined the Company in April 1979. His previous titles include Chief Director of Procurement, Deputy Chief Senior Director of Development and Production, Chief Senior Director of Development, Chief Director of Business Strategy and Chief Director of PDI in the Company. He used to be General Manager and Director in a Chinabased subsidiary. since 2017.

Hitachi Construction Machinery Co., Ltd., together with its subsidiaries, engages in the manufacture, sale, rental, and service of construction and transportation machinery, and other machines and devices worldwide. Hitachi Construction Machinery Co., Ltd. is a subsidiary of Hitachi, Ltd. Hitachi Construction operates under Farm Heavy Construction Machinery classification in the United States and is traded on OTC Exchange. It employs 24987 people.
